数据结构是计算机专业考研考试中的一个重点。学习数据结构需要有一定的计算机语言基础。比如C语言,C++等等。没有语言基础的同学会很吃力。并且,很多例子、题目,甚至结构都是用编程语言表达的,部分考试题目也会要求你用伪代码或者某种语言编程作答。下面文都考研网小编就为大家介绍一下数据结构这个知识点:

数据结构的考试内容包括:线性表、栈、队列和数组、树和二叉树、图、查找和内部排序。考生复习时首先要深刻理解数据结构的三要素:逻辑结构、存储结构以及在其上定义的各种基本操作,要把复习的重点放在掌握常用数据结构的这三个要素上面。

举例来说,栈这种数据结构有两种实现方式(即存储方式):顺序栈和链式栈,经过一到两轮的复习之后,考生应该能够比较熟练地使用C语言(当然也可以用C++等高级语言)写出这两种方式下栈的定义以及初始化、进栈、出栈、返回栈顶元素等各种阿基本操作的算法实现,有条件的同学,可以上机调试算法。也就是说,对于每一种常用的数据结构,在掌握了它的逻辑结构和存储结构后,一定要亲自动手,自己写出各种基本操作的算法实现,这个过程需要认真体会和反复琢磨。

只有熟练掌握了这些基本算法以后,才能在此基础上对常用的数据结构进行比较灵活的运用,而对于数据结构的灵活运用,正是这门课程的难点所在。“数据结构”是计算机、软件工程专业考研时,最经常考的科目之一,也是很多同学头疼的科目。建议大家集中火力重点击破这个知识点。更多计算机考研知识点,快来文都考研网学习吧!